> I also reduced the ACP of Elephants in the Advances game in an attempt
> to make that unit type less deity-like and thereby make other units
> such as Chariots more attractive.

Something needed to be done, that's for sure.  Elephants were very
powerful and dirt-cheap to build (in terms of what advances you need
to get that far).  I don't know if ACP alone will really fix the
problem.  It might also be necessarily to play with the hit-chance
(for example, the help hints that elephants are particularly good
against cavalry.  Well, maybe they aren't so hot against other kinds
of units).
